I received the 3D mascara to facilitate my review. I was not compensated monetarily, and all opinions are honest and my own.

I’ve got short, pale eyelashes, and if I’m not wearing mascara, it almost looks from afar like I just don’t have eyelashes at all. I’ve heard a lot of good things about the Younique Moodstruck 3D Fiber Lashes, but of course until I tried it myself I was a little skeptical. I’ve tried a lot of mascaras over the years, and I wondered if this one was really any different.

The mascara comes in a case and has two tubes – one is a transplanting gel, and one is the actual fibers.

Younique_Opened

Younique-Mascara

Younique-Fibers

I was nervous that application might be tricky, but it’s really a breeze. I did a thin layer of the transplanting gel, and then right afterward used the fibers; then followed up with another layer of transplanting gel to seal the fibers in. So easy! Then I decided to make the lashes just on the outer edges of my eyes a little longer, so I did a second round of gel, fibers, and gel. Watch this pic and you can see my eyes before, after one round, and after two rounds. I love the effect of the 3D Fiber Lashes!

I love to decorate for all the various holidays, and with Fourth of July right around the corner that means a lot of red, white, & blue.

One of my favorite low-cost methods of decorating is by displaying framed printables. Just buy some inexpensive frames (it’s especially fun to go thrifting or antiquing to find unique options) and paint them to fit with your aesthetic; then it’s so easy to swap out art as the various holidays roll around!

I love the idea of layering frames with different printables along a mantle or tabletop – you can easily achieve pops of color, and you can find all sorts of great quotes on Pinterest. Of course, since I’m a graphic designer I like to create my own printables so I can achieve the look – and convey the thoughts – that really fit our family.

I created a new Fourth of July printable recently and I’m sharing it with you today so you can add it to your patriotic decor. Just click here to start your free PDF download. This is sized for an 8×10 frame, but you can print it smaller for 5×7 if you prefer.

Peanut Butter Cookie Squares

I’ve made peanut butter cookies more times than I can count. They’re one of Brian’s favorite cookies, and the rest of us happen to love them too, so they’re a logical go-to whenever I’m in the mood to bake. I had never really deviated from my standard recipe, until my peanut butter world was rocked with a brownie I tried. It was a peanut butter-chocolate brownie, and it was amazing. And it had hints of – wait for it – cinnamon. Totally unexpected, right? I knew then that I’d have to try incorporating cinnamon into my next batch of peanut butter cookies, and boy am I glad I did. The result is a thick, soft cookie with crispy edges, and a subtle warmth complimenting the salty flavor of the peanut butter.

These peanut butter cookie squares are quick to make because you don’t have to scoop out individual cookies – I just press the dough out into a cookie sheet with raised sides, just like this one. I wanted the cookies to still have a quaint touch, but since making marks with forks would be difficult to do en masse, I pulled out our rocker-style pizza cutter and gently scored the top of the dough, giving it a quilted effect.

Beautiful and delicious. Easy, too.
